Trekkers reach Punta Cuyoc (16,200 feet or 4950 m pass), beneath Nevados Puscanturpa. Day 5 of 9 days trekking around the Cordillera Huayhuash in the Andes Mountains, Peru, South America. In the distance, see Siula Grande (center left 20,814 ft or 6344 m), which was the subject of the gripping 2003 British docudrama "Touching the Void." In 1985, climbers Joe Simpson and Simon Yates scaled the treacherous West Face of Siula Grande, but after Joe broke his leg, their descent became one of the most amazing survival stories in mountaineering history. The 2003 movie is based upon Joe Simpson's harrowing book, "Touching the Void: The True Story of One Man's Miraculous Survival."
